North Little Rock, AR - LHP Domingo Robles guided the Springfield Cardinals (4-5) through 8.0 nearly hitless innings en route to the 4-0 shutout win against the Arkansas Travelers (5-4) on Saturday at Dickey-Stephens Park. The only hit that the Cardinals allowed all night was a groundball to short to leadoff the 7th inning that SS Delvin Perez fielded but threw low to 1st base, which ultimately was ruled a single by the official scorer.

Decisions:
W - LHP Domingo Robles (1-0)
L - RHP Taylor Dollard (0-1)

Notables:
LHP Domingo Robles finished with 8.0 one-hit innings, not allowing a run while walking three and striking out three... RHP Freddy Pacheco dealt a perfect 9th inning to slam the door... LF Matt Koperniak provided the first run of the night with the go-ahead RBI sac fly in the 2nd... RF Moises Gomez belted his league-best 6th home run of the season with a two-run shot in the 7th... DH Jordan Walker went 3x5 with his second straight three-hit game.
